Title: Foolproof falafel burgers
Cook: Chris Lock
Serves: 4-6
Preparation Time: 15-20 minutes
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es
Ingrediants
- 2 x 400 g Canned chickpeas, drained and washed
- 1 Small onion cut into chunks
- 1 handful parsley leaves
- 1 Zest and juice of lemon
- 2 teaspoons Ground cumin and ground coriander
- 6 tablespoons Plain flour plus extra for dusting
- 4 tablespoons Olive oil
- 4 Burger buns
- Red onion, spicy tomato salsa and plain yoghurt to serve
Method:
- Tip the first ingredients into a food processor. Season with pepper, and salt if you like, then pulse until you have a chunky paste. Tip the past onto a floured work surface and mould it into 4 burger shaped patties.
- Dust the patties in a little more flour. Heat the oil in a large non-stick pan and fry the burgers for 2 minutes on each side until crisp
- Serve in the buns with sliced red onion, spoonfuls of salsa and yoghurt and any other burger relishes you fancy
